Transaction e20daf5b6476d318804f5aa78fa877b98c398f1c7d590997cfafef69f3017626
1 Input
1 Output
-
e20daf5b6476d318804f5aa78fa877b98c398f1c7d590997cfafef69f3017626:0
- value
- 1775457
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2c51ba54d738d8fc922d974268facbe8fe99a2c
- address
- bc1qutz3hf2dwwxcljfzm96zdravh687nx3v4kwsrn